The 21-year-old South African striker Kurt Abrahams scored his fifth goal of the season to help guide Belgian First Division club KVC Westerlo to a 2-0 win over KSV Roeselare.

Kurt Abrahams

The young forward made his 12th start of the season and scored his fifth goal of the season as he continues to impress in Belgium. The result saw Westerlo snap a four-match winless streak to take them fourth on the log after three games in period two of the league.

Lebogang Phiri

The 24-year-old midfielder didn’t add to his five Ligue 1 appearances, as he was an unused substitute in Guingamp’s 0-0 draw with Nice. The result was Phiri’s side’s first points in the league in four games as they continue to sit bottom of the Ligue 1 table, with just eight points from their 15 games played.

Thulani Serero

Serero, who recently returned to the Bafana Bafana set-up after a year-long hiatus, started his 13th game of the season, but failed to have an impact as Vitesse drew 1-1 with Emmen. A result which saw the Dutch club drop down to sixth on the table after 14 matches.

Percy Tau

Bafana Bafana’s star striker failed to add to his three goals and four assists for Belian second division side Union Saint-Gilloise in his 13th game as Tau’s side slumped to a 2-0 loss to Tubize. The result leaves Saint-Gilloise fifth on the log after three games in period two of the Belgian second tier.

Siphiwe Tshabalala

After looking like he was finally finding his feet in Turkey, making his second start at Erzurumspor last week, former Chiefs star Shabba was left out of his side’s match day squad. Tshabalala’s side’s struggles continued as they went down 2-1 to Bursaspor, leaving them 14th on the log after 14 matches.

Lars Veldwijk

The big striker has caught the eye of many this season, scoring 13 goals for Dutch second-tier club Sparta Rotterdam.

He, however, couldn’t add to his goal tally as his side suffered a surprise 3-0 loss to bottom-of-the-log Helmond Sport, who snapped their 10-game unbeaten streak that saw them drop to third on the log after 16 games.
